软件工程专业的会涉及到相当多的编程软件,像是基本的java,python等,今天小编就来为大家详细介绍一下格拉斯哥大学软件工程专业的java课程的主要内容,感兴趣的同学可以接着看下去了。
【格拉斯哥大学java编程课程介绍】
课程概述:
本课程扩展了学生使用强类型语言(Java)编程的经验,并加强了他们解决问题的技能。学生将学习支持面向对象编程的思想,并将在开发中小型软件系统中应用这些概念。学生还将学习选择和重用现有的软件组件和库,并将获得并发编程和基本图形用户界面(GUI)开发的经验。
所属院系:计算机学科学学院-软件工程专业
学分:10分
课程代码:COMpSCI2001
课程评估:
1、学位考试60%
2、实验室检查(20%)
3、实验室练习(20%)
课程目标:
1、进一步发展学生使用强类型语言(Java)编程的经验,并加强他们解决问题的技能;
2、介绍支持面向对象编程的思想,并确保学生获得在开发中小型软件系统中适当利用这些概念的能力;
3、 培养从标准库的有限子集中选择和重用现有软件组件和库的能力;
4、介绍和发展并发编程的实践经验,并探索各种并发控制机制。
学习成果:
1. 使用Java编程语言的所有特性来构建实际的单线程程序;
2. 描述Java的对象模型;
3. 解释单一和多重继承层次的重要性;以及实现和接口继承;
4. 解释并行编程的目的和固有的缺陷;
5. 展示基本的面向对象设计技能;
6. 使用基本原则构建结构良好的中等大小的Java程序适当的类库。
以上就是为大家整理的格拉斯哥大学软件工程专业java课程的全部资讯,大家如果在课程中遇到问题的话可以随时在线联系我们进行辅导哦~